Abstract
A battery case made of an intumescent flame retardant polymeric composition that provides fire shielding, thermal shielding and a low heat release rate. A fire resistant additive is blended with a base polymer to produce the flame retardant polymeric material that is molded into the battery case. In one embodiment, one or more vent holes are provided in the battery case, advantageously in the cover portion, to permit gases to escape. In another embodiment, the fire resistant additive used for the battery case composition comprises a polymeric binder that includes an α-olefin-containing copolymer and a high density polyethylene, a nitrogenous gas-generating agent; a water vapor-generating agent; an antioxidant; and optionally a reinforcing agent. In another embodiment, the base polymer comprises a polyphenylene oxide and polypropylene blend, unfilled or filled with up to 60 wt. % glass fiber.

15. A battery case comprising:
-
a base portion having a bottom and side walls forming an interior compartment for holding a battery cell and internal structural components; and
a cover portion engaging the side walls for enclosing the compartment, wherein the base portion and cover portion are formed of a flame retardant polymeric composition comprising a base polymer and a fire resistant additive, wherein the fire resistant additive comprises, on the basis of 100 parts by weight blended mixture;
20-45 parts of a polymeric binder comprising high density polyethylene having a density in the range of 0.940-0.970 g/cm3 and an α
-olefin-containing copolymer having a density less than the density of the high density polyethylene;
5-25 parts of a nitrogenous gas-generating agent selected from the group consisting of amines, ureas, guanidines, guanamines, s-triazines, amino acids, salts thereof, and mixtures thereof, wherein the salts are selected from the group consisting of phosphates, phosphonates, phosphinates, borates, cyanurates, sulfates and mixtures thereof;
10-35 parts of a water vapor-generating agent;
1-5 parts of an antioxidant; and
0-15 parts of a reinforcing agent, wherein the flame retardant polymeric composition is essentially halogen-free. - View Dependent Claims (16, 17, 18, 19, 20, 21, 22, 23, 24, 25, 26, 27, 28, 29)
